Simplify (6^5 over 7^3)^2

Mathematics
1 answer:
love history [14]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

6^10 over 7^6.

Step-by-step explanation:

(6^5 over 7^3)^2

= 6^(5*2) / 7^(3*2)

=  6^10 over 7^6.
